High-quality materials & durable PVD finish
The glass clamp is made of lead-free brass and finished with a high-quality PVD coating. This innovative finish creates an extremely strong, colorfast, and scratch-resistant surface that is resistant to moisture and daily use. This ensures the glass clamp will remain beautiful for years to come, even in a heavily used bathroom. Specification:
* U-shaped mounting brackets with horizontal mounting leg
* 90 degree glass-floor or wall connection
* Suitable for 10mm glass
Color: Brushed Gun Metal
Material: Brass (lead-free) with PVD finish
